  2. Quote:
    Originally Posted by Kitsune Knight View Post
    If it's the same number, then that's likely the case (I thought you were supposed to get a new number when you got a new card issued?).
    If lost or stolen. Cards reissued for expiration dates nearing are almost always the same number.
    Quote:
    Originally Posted by mousedroid View Post
    Maybe if you report the credit/debit card lost or stolen. If the card just expires, you should get a new card with the same account number and a new expiration date. They may update the CVV number or whatever it's called, but not the account number. I had a credit card with the same number for close to 20 years before I finally cancelled the account.
    This. I think if my current card is still in my possession (I have a horrendous rate of losing them in the most peculiar places until I get a new one issued) so I am forced to relearn the numbers... XD

  13. Quote:
    Originally Posted by Sam_Sneed View Post
    I thought that was how it worked. Just wanted to make sure before making the investment. Thanks alot for the feedback!
    By the way, a Io being marked unique has nothing to do with how it works.

    Unique merely means you can only slot one per build, and if a pre-existing IO is marked unique, all but one will disappear from a build.

  16. Quote:
    Originally Posted by Decorum View Post
    Sadly, you have to go to EACH and EVERY post and click the little scales to see the comments (and if there weren't any, it just tells you your current rep points). I stopped looking a while ago.
    People kept leaving bad comments (I think some idiots actually thought the mods couldn't see who left what, despite it being anonymous from our POV) and ignore didn't stop people from commenting on you (if you had them on ignore, you would still see their rep comments). Between the two, it was disabled.
    Quote:
    Originally Posted by Ironblade View Post
    Partly. The amount of effect you have is based on your rep, number of forum posts and years since you registered on the forums.
    Your +/- rep value is based on your rep, post count/1000 (iirc), +1 per full registered year. So my rep flags have, ignoring my rep, 19 points of rep. Also, I think neg rep is also halved (it's easier to gain than lose rep).

    Also, I want to say there is a "rep comparison" between you and whoever you rep, so if you have 0 rep, and you rep someone with major rep... it doesn't count :P

    Decent amount of details out there if you Google "vBulletin Rep System"

  23. Rajani Isa

    AT Differences?

    Quote:
    Originally Posted by Another_Fan View Post
    Build Up, Against All Odds and a few medium reds.
    But unlike teaming, those last for a very limited amount of time. Not a constant max like teaming with Kins and such.


    As for the damage caps, Scrappers at base damage (100% of 500% cap) are about a brute at 240% (+140%) of the 850% cap. If I remember right, a brute at the damage cap is about equal to a scrapper at 600% (so another 100% beyond the scrapper damage cap).
